The August 2019 publication of Monthly Translation and Analyses Digest monitoring Chinese government media on Tibet includes the following articles:

  • China to intensify ‘struggles against Dalai Clique and evil forces’ in Tibet Autonomous Region
  • “Reincarnation not a matter of individual right but a symbol of Party’s rule over Tibet”
  • Inspection teams to investigate the enforcement of Grassland Law dispatched
  • 40 million kWh of hydropower transferred from TAR to Beijing in July
  • UFWD seminar claims Tibetan reincarnation system related to China’s political stability
  • “Tibetan Buddhist colleges must be turned into important centres of patriotic education”
  • Chinese provincial governor affirms commitment to aid-Tibet program’s political objectives
  • Special photo exhibition on Tibetan reincarnation system held at Pelkor Chode Monastery in Gyantse

Tibetan Center for Human Rights and Democracy – North America, is a 501(c) (3) non-profit founded and incorporated in October 2019 in the state of California. The Center is run by its Director and volunteers.
